Paper Report for: Rochu_1998_Biochim.Biophys.Acta_1385_126

Reference

Title: Purification, molecular characterization and catalytic properties of a Pseudomonas fluorescens enzyme having cholinesterase-like activity
Rochu D, Rothlisberger C, Taupin C, Renault F, Gagnon J, Masson P
Ref: Biochimica & Biophysica Acta, 1385:126, 1998 : PubMed

        



Comment
This enzyme (A0A1H1NUJ2_9PSED in UniProt) is not an alpha/beta hydrolase. Instead it belongs to the family SBP_bac_8 (PF13416) included in the clan Periplasmic binding protein PBP (CL0177) in Pfam. It is also unrelated to the Pseudomonas aeruginosa enzyme described by Sanchez et al.
